摘要

This report describes the results of implementing an interrupt handler totally in Ada for a MicroVax II/VAXELN 2.3 target system, the VAXELN 1.1 Ada compiler, and a KWV11-C programmable real-time clock. It provides an overview of VAXELN interrupt handlers and the operation of the real-time clock; discusses and demonstrates the use of VAXELN kernel services to establish a link between the clock's interrupt and the starting address an interrupt service routine; presents an Ada package of interfaces to the KWV11-C device; provides Ada source code examples demonstrating the use of this package; and presents relevant observations, recommendations, and measurement results.
